Cabot Creamery has held B Corp certification since 2012 and became the world's first dairy co-op to do so. This certification demonstrates our commitment to transforming the global economy to benefit all people, communities, and the planet.
Our dairy cooperative is seeking a regular, full-time Butter Machine Operator. This is a full time (40 hours/week), 2nd shift (3:00 pm- 11:00 pm) position. It offers a base rate pay range of $27.02/hr. - $29.08/hr. per hour plus 7% shift differential. This position also offers eligibility for rate increases every 6 months for the first 18 months of employment. There are also ample opportunities for advancement with this entry level position.
The Butter Operator will operate butter packaging equipment, follow and understand production schedule, maintain facility in a sanitary manner, including Clean-in-Place (CIP) washing of equipment and cleaning of walls, floors and ceilings. Restock butter packaging materials to meet production and maintain materials in an appropriate, orderly fashion.
